Understanding the Risks of Displaying Political Signs in Your Yard
As the election season heats up, many homeowners are eager to show their political support through yard signs. However, they should be aware of the potential risks involved. Homeowners associations often have strict guidelines regarding signage. Displaying signs that exceed size limits can lead to fines or removal requests. Additionally, even if you live in an area without an HOA, your neighbors may not appreciate your political views. This could lead to uncomfortable situations or conflicts.

How Political Signs Can Affect Home Sales and Neighborhood Dynamics
Political signs can significantly impact home sales. Real estate agents often advise clients to keep their properties neutral, especially during election seasons. A politically charged yard can deter potential buyers who may feel uncomfortable with the displayed views. Additionally, a neighbor’s political display can affect your property’s appeal. Buyers are not just purchasing a home; they are investing in a community.
